1. Text color red on Discord

The language diff” is used to write text in red. It is also advisable to put a dash (-) at the beginning of the text in this frame.

This means type :

```diff
- of text
- and a dash on each line
```

This is the what it looks like:

2. Text color orange on Discord

The language arm is used for the color orange, simply write the text and space it out using an underscore (_). So, to get the desired result, type:

```arm
du_texte
encore_du_texte
```

This should result in this format :

3. Text color green on Discord

The language diff” is also used for green, but in this case a more (+) in front of the text. Here's an example:

```diff
+ some text
+ and a plus on each line
```

This given code :

4. Turquoise text color on Discord

To set your text in turquoise, the language “py” is to be used. To guide you, here's the formula:

```py
"infinite text...
and here again".
```

And here's what should stand out:

5. Text color blue on Discord

The code “apache” allows you to put text in blue. In this case, your message must begin with the symbol <Here is an example of how to use this code:

```apache
<du texte
here too
```

This gives :

6. Text color in gray on Discord

The code “python” is used in this context. To achieve the desired effect, you must write:

```python
# text
# more text
```

Which give :

FAQs

How does markdown work on Discord?

the markdown is a simple formatting system that allows you to change the appearance of text or words on Discord. The system requires characters to be added before and after text to change its format.

What to do when the colors don't change?

In most cases, if the colors do not change, the problem is due to a syntax error in the code. Always remember to check if you haven't used a space where you shouldn't have or if you've put a different symbol.

Syntax errors are often encountered when first starting to use codes on Discord. With a little practicethe problem should be solved.

How do I italicize text on Discord?

To write in italics on Discord, use * Where _ on either side of the text (left and right).

Example : *Italic*, _Italic_, Normal

How do I bold text on Discord?

To make text in bold (for highlighting), use ** on either side of the text.

Example : **Bold**, Not fat

How do I underline text on Discord?

To underline text, use __ on either side of the text.

Example : __Underlined__, Not underlined

How do I cross out text on Discord?

To cross out text, use ~~ on either side of the text.

Example : ~~Strikethrough~~, Not strikethrough

How to make a spoiler (hidden message) on Discord?

To avoid highlighting certain messages, you can use a feature on Discord to hide them. Here are more details on this. This feature applies to both texts than pictures.

Hide text

To hide a message on discord:

  • Simply set || on either side text.

Example : ||I am hidden!|| Not me...

Is it possible to mix codes on Discord?

And yes, with Discord, you can make mixtures, ie a text in bold and underlined, Where italic and strikethrough. Or even, if you wish, a bold, italic, underline, strikethrough, and spoiler text!

  • For example, the coded to be used in the latter case is : ||___***~~votre texte~~***___||.

Yellow frame on Discord

Do you ever see a yellow box around certain messages? That's normal! It means that someone tagged you or replied to one of your messages.

Large print on Discord

To write in large characters on Discord, add a #, followed by a spacing and then send your message.

Changing the appearance/theme on Discord: How do I do it?

To change theme On the Discord app, proceed as follows:

  • First, all you need to do is click on the gearwheel user settings, then select "Appearance" from the menu on the left.

  • There are various combinations of settings you can make. Scroll until you find Appearance.
  • Above, you have three choices for selecting your theme: Dark, Clair and Synchronized with the computer.

  • The dark theme : gives the application interface the color dark grey/anthracite with white used as the default text color.
  • the theme Clair : gives the interface a white tint with dark gray as the default text color.
  • On mobile devices, it is possible to synchronize the appearance of your Discord application with your device's appearance settings.
